The fierce battle for the Holy Grail continues with part one of a three-part anime movie series, Fate/stay night: Heaven’s Feel – I. Unlike the other adaptations of the MMORPG series, Ordinal Scale is an original work by Reki Kawahara that links between the Mother’s Rosario arc and the upcoming third season Alicization arc. And while the Augma is less risky than its predecessor, it seems ghosts of the past are hunting the SAO survivors. The online adventure continues with SAO: Ordinal Scale, but this time around, the gang will be trading in their AmuSphere for the Augma. Princess Mononoke: In order to lift the curse of a vengeful god, warrior-prince Ashitaka travels to Iron Town which is haunted by Princess Mononoke, a girl raised by wolf gods. Recommended for being Alice in Wonderland in Japan. Spirited Away: A family is transported to the spirit realm and it is up to Chihiro, an only child, to rescue her parents and find a way back home. Critically acclaimed, Ghost in the Shell asks poignant questions about the nature of life in a world where most of the population is robotic in some capacity. Why I Recommend It: This is a classic for many genres not exclusive to anime including cyberpunk, science fiction, and animation as a whole.
